#b4e8ba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4e8ba is composed of 70.6% red, 91%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.8%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 126.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.1% and a lightness of 80.8%. #b4e8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#69d175.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#b4e8ba color description : Very soft lime green.
#b4e8ba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4e8ba has RGB values of R:180, G:232,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 11856058.
